About Montgomery County Health Department
The Montgomery County Health Department in Hillsboro, Illinois, offers outpatient behavioral health services for all ages. They have DUI classes, substance use treatment and psychological services. Hillsboro is their main office, and they can provide referrals to more intensive services as needed.
I noticed that the clinic has evidence based addiction treatment that lasts at least three months. They focus on addressing denial and other barriers to treatment as well as coping skills, values and self esteem. Participants can also present their own discussion topics.
Group Therapy Options for Youth
I really liked the fact that they have a wide variety of group options for young people. The Happiness in Social Situations group is for kids struggling with behavioral issues at school or home. It presents scenarios and helps the kids talk through how to handle them in healthy ways.
The Choose Now Group is for teens who are making risky decisions, which may include substance use. The group provides a framework for healthy decision-making and points out where poor choices can lead. Group activities include videos, trips and presentations from others who have made similar choices.
DUI Services in Montgomery County
Their DUI services provide court approved evaluations and education for Level I and Level II DUI offenses. The classes include at least 10 hours of education and a written exam. To complete the requirements, participants must pass the exam. Then they can reapply for their driver’s license.
